Like I said, the avatars were working before but all of a sudden some users started getting those little question marks and as far as I know, we haven't changed any avatar settings  ☹️ 

It means this you've done something recently. You should remember it. Have you changed Forum Accesses or usergroup permissions? Please navigate to Dashboard > Forums > Usergroups admin page, edit all usergroups, make sure the "Can upload avatar" and "Can view avatar" permissions are enabled then save them. After this navigate to Dashboard > Forums > Dashboard and click on [Delete all Caches] button.

If it doesn't work please disable other plugins (especially WP User Avatar, other recent updated / installed). Delete website cache, then forum cache and test it again.
